Transaction 3e5a76cff810aa27b5af34e557ab4ee5f921bbdbb25ed6ce11cb8749f9526e51

block
0818096cf54f6aa0a840e6c140974d6bf561d492c1d7eb5d573be0fe3e5ebd6a

1 Input

62 Outputs